Today’s card uses the totally gorgeous Pretty Peacock, combined with Bermuda Bay and Coastal Cabana.  Gorgeous, gorgeous, I love these colours!!
Pretty Peacock Butterflies
Butterflies from the Butterfly Gala stamp set have been heat embossed with white embossing powder, and then punched out with the matching Butterfly Duet punch.  The white layer behind the butterflies has been run through the Big Shot in the Pinewood Planks embossing folder.

Other than those few Old Olive leaves, the only colour I have used on my card is Melon Mambo.  I have used the technique called “Stamping Off” to reduce the amount of ink on the stamp, making it into a lighter colour, and making it look like a number of different pink colours have been used, instead of just the one.
Then I have used Two Step stamping to stamp the raised flowers which I have fussy cut and layered over the top.

I have used the retiring (sadly) Sheet Music background stamp to add some music images onto the background of the lighter coloured parts.  To do this, I didn’t mount the stamp onto a block, but just splodged some ink (that’s a technical term, by the way) onto part of the stamp and then rolled it, kind of randomly, onto the cardstock.

The edges have been distressed and then sponged with Early Espresso ink.
And I have coloured the main birds nest image.  The nest and leaves were coloured with Stampin’ Blends (Alcohol Ink Markers) in Old Olive and Crumb Cake, the eggs were coloured using Blender Pen and ink pad in Balmy Blue, and the tiny flower dots were coloured using a Flirty Flamingo Stampin’ Write Marker.
